Madam Hwa and the Hwayang people, looking as if they had returned from the dead, finally understood why the other two races had vanished so quickly. Even if the high priests of those races were superior to Madam Hwa, they wouldn’t have been able to withstand the Divine Light of Immortal Extermination.

The Aura Clan was far beyond the level that she and the other Hwayang people could handle. Whether they could overcome the current crisis depended entirely on Han Li.

‘Master Han, please be careful. The Divine Light of Immortal Extermination not only deflects attacks but is also unaffected by most divine powers or restrictions and contains an extreme poison. Once an attack lands, the poison spreads throughout the body and cannot be removed. That’s why I heard many of our clan’s experts died from that evil light long ago,’ Madam Hwa said, worried about the silver firebird that had swallowed the Divine Light of Immortal Extermination and returned to Han Li’s body.

‘Extreme poison!’

This was unexpected information. However, if the Western Spirit Heavenly Flame could swallow the Divine Light of Immortal Extermination, there was no way it couldn’t handle the poison. He kept his eyes on the two Aura people.

‘To swallow the Divine Light of Immortal Extermination!’

Although the faces of the Aura royals inside the black barrier were not visible, it was clear from their voices that they were quite surprised.

‘Haha, I’ve enjoyed watching your divine powers. It’s a shame you didn’t master them to the extreme, so they were easily subdued. It seems you came here intending to ambush and kill them, so I’ll finish my work quickly and go back to my rest!’ Han Li said with a light smile, striding forward. With each step, the distance closed rapidly, and he reached the Aura royals in an instant.

At that moment, golden light burst from Han Li’s body, and golden armor appeared, with a golden glow floating above his head. At the center of the glow, a golden dharma image [a divine representation] with three heads and six arms sat cross-legged. Two of the dharma image’s three heads had the same face as Han Li and shone with golden light. When Han Li revealed his bizarre divine power, not only the Aura royals but also the Hwayang people were astonished.

Wooong!

The black radiance vibrated and distorted, transforming into a huge blade about seven or eight feet long that cut through the air. The giant blade mysteriously flashed with gold and silver lightning. Seeing it, Han Li raised one hand and grasped the air. Then, the golden dharma image above his head opened its eyes wide, and its six arms moved in the same way as Han Li.

Kwaang!

A giant golden hand appeared in the air and collided with the black blade. Black and gold light surged, and the giant golden hand blocked the black blade in the air. At this, the Aura person with golden eyes was greatly surprised and formed a hand seal to attack Han Li with the poisonous stinger of her scorpion-like lower body. The Aura person with silver eyes, standing next to her, also revealed a cunning glint and opened her mouth to roar.

Then, white mist rose above her head, and within the shimmering silver light, a huge illusion of a human-faced centipede appeared. The silver light flashed, and the illusion of the human-faced centipede also attacked Han Li.

However, even with the combined attack of the two Aura royals, Han Li remained expressionless. He flicked one sleeve, summoning dozens of blue swords, and the small swords turned blue and rushed towards the incoming golden poisonous stingers.

Wooong!

Numerous spell characters floated on the golden poisonous stingers, indicating how powerful this divine power was. However, as the blue light flashed, the golden poisonous stingers shattered into pieces within the blue sword lights. At the sight of this, the two Aura people were greatly shocked. But Han Li didn’t stop there; he stretched out his hand and spread a gray barrier, blocking the silver energy emitted by the human-faced centipede illusion.

At the same time, a small, dark mountain rose from Han Li’s hand. Han Li glanced at the human-faced centipede and moved the small mountain, and a wave rippled above the human-faced centipede as the small mountain appeared. As soon as the mountain appeared, it swelled madly, becoming a black peak that fell onto the back of the human-faced centipede. The centipede hissed in pain and, unable to withstand the immense pressure, fell.

At this, the Aura person with silver eyes hurriedly spun her hands like windmills, forming hand seals, and silver characters appeared on her face. In the end, she spat out a mouthful of silver essence blood, transforming it into silver spell characters that she absorbed into the body of the human-faced centipede. The human-faced centipede shook its head and tail with all its might, trying to overturn the black mountain. Seeing this, Han Li raised his black palm and muttered, ‘Become heavier.’

At this, the black mountain vibrated, emitting a strange gray-white light, and in an instant, it swelled more than ten times, pressing down even harder on the human-faced centipede. The human-faced centipede, which had barely stopped falling, eventually fell helplessly and crashed to the ground.

Kuang!

A deafening roar shook the entire great hall, and a huge hole was punched through the floor. The black mountain spun in the center of the pit, and the human-faced centipede below let out a final scream and scattered into silver light, disappearing. The moment the illusion of the human-faced centipede disappeared, the Aura person with silver eyes, pale and terrified, vomited blood. This time, it was not silver blood but dark red, dead blood.

As the Aura person with silver eyes was severely injured, the other Aura person moved behind her and struck her back. Then, a great golden and silver light burst from the body of the silver Aura person, and her condition improved significantly. However, Han Li snorted and simultaneously sent dozens of blue flying swords into the air.

‘……!’

The Aura people showed fear and grasped each other’s shoulders, and a black radiance appeared, completely enveloping them. At that moment, dozens of blue threads reached the black radiance. As Han Li formed a hand seal in his mind, the numerous flying swords became ambiguous and turned into blurry illusions. It was the divine power of Sword Spirit Transformation, which Han Li had obtained after refining the flying swords. The swords circled around the black radiance and then shot out like arrows, piercing through it. The Aura people quickly flew up on black threads.

However, the sword lights, already at close range, would not let them go. As the sword lights intersected, terrible screams erupted, and numerous holes were pierced through the bodies of the two Aura people. From afar, Madam Hwa and the Hwayang people showed expressions of joy. However, Han Li activated his Brightspirit Vision [a technique to see spiritual energy] and went to the side of the two corpses, grasping the nearby air.

Whir!

As silver flames rose from his palm, golden and silver lights appeared and were engulfed in the flames. They were golden and silver centipedes. The centipedes writhed in the silver flames, looking at him with terrified faces. Han Li had no intention of letting the Aura people’s nascent souls [souls in early stage of development] go. Their nascent souls gradually shrank in the silver flames, then lost their light and silently disappeared into blue smoke.

Han Li had eliminated the Aura royals, but he was not particularly pleased. Of course, the two Aura people were not enough to be Han Li’s opponents, but he was bothered by the fact that he could not initially grasp their cultivation. So, Han Li focused on their corpses. He reached out, and the two corpses flew to him, and he examined them closely with his Brightspirit Vision.

Shuk! Shuk!

As he blinked his eyes and gestured, two black handkerchiefs flew up and into his hand. After looking down at them for a moment, Han Li turned his palm over and pocketed the black handkerchiefs.

‘Thank you so much. The Hwayang Clan will never forget Senior Han’s grace for generations to come,’ Madam Hwa approached with Baek Ju-ah, her face flushed with excitement. However, she pretended not to notice the black handkerchiefs that Han Li had taken. Through this battle, she felt that Han Li was an even stronger being than she had thought, feeling both gratitude and fear at the same time. Baek Ju-ah was also very impressed by Han Li’s divine powers. She kept her small mouth tightly shut and said nothing, but her gaze towards him was full of respect. The other Hwayang priests also approached, their faces full of smiles and showing a respectful attitude.

‘Haha, it was nothing! Since I agreed to help, I’ll take care of the Aura people outside as well,’ Han Li said, glancing at them with a light smile.

Han Li immediately retrieved the flying swords and the black mountain, and this time, he released a lump of golden light. Then, a small beast resembling a leopard appeared, circling in the air. It was the Leopard Scaled Beast. Madam Hwa and the snake-people paused for a moment upon seeing the spirit beast, then scanned the small beast with their consciousness and gasped. The pressure of the spiritual energy that the small beast was emitting was higher than Madam Hwa’s.

‘Go and kill all the Aura people,’ Han Li ordered. The Leopard Scaled Beast’s eyes flashed fiercely, and its form blurred, transforming into seven or eight illusions that shot out of the great hall. Madam Hwa’s expression changed from moment to moment before she finally regained her composure. Then, as if she had thought of something, she took out a spirit tablet from her bosom, pointed it at the air, and chanted a spell. The spirit tablet glowed, surrounding the great hall, and the five-colored radiance disappeared.

‘Now that things are settled, I should go back and rest. The spirit beast will return to me on its own after finishing its work, so don’t worry about it,’ Han Li calmly said and transformed into a blue streak of light, leaving the great hall.

‘If Master Han had not been here, the entire Hwayang Clan would have been annihilated,’ one of the snake-people sighed after Han Li disappeared.

‘That’s right. At first, I couldn’t understand why the high priest gave the Yang-Melting Pill to an outsider, but if it weren’t for the high priest’s wise decision, we wouldn’t have been able to overcome this crisis,’ another snake priest nodded vigorously. However, Madam Hwa just smiled bitterly.

‘There’s no need to praise me so much. It was all done with the feeling of grasping at straws. Heaven must have blessed our clan and sent Master Han to us. Ju-ah, in your opinion, how does Master Han’s cultivation compare to your master’s?’ Madam Hwa asked. Baek Ju-ah narrowed her brow and pondered for a long time.

‘Although my master is a being of the fifth level of the Upper Realm, he would not be able to kill the Aura royals so easily,’ the girl answered. Madam Hwa nodded as if she understood. At this, the four priests next to her looked puzzled.

‘If Master Han is a being of the high level of the Upper Realm, wouldn’t even the Silver Envoy, who is said to be the strongest in the nearby sea, be no match for him?’

‘That’s hard to say for sure. Even if their cultivation is similar, the outcome can vary depending on each person’s cultivation method, divine powers, or treasures,’ the madam sighed deeply and carefully expressed her opinion. At her words, the other snake priests readily nodded.

‘How long will Master Han stay on our Hwaun Island? Is there any chance he might consider residing here for a long time?’ one of the priests hesitated before asking.

‘That’s also hard to say for sure. He may not leave immediately, but I don’t think he will stay for long. With Master Han’s cultivation, would he stay in a small clan like ours?’ Madam Hwa shook her head, as if she had already considered it. At her words, the other snake-people fell into thought, and the great hall became silent.

‘Alright. Let’s discuss this matter later and focus on finishing the battle outside. Although we killed the Aura royals, there are still high-level Aura people left. Even if Master Han’s spirit beast is strong, it can’t kill all the Aura people. Let’s go to the battlefield quickly and minimize the damage,’ Madam Hwa quickly scanned the great hall and gave the order. Then, the Hwayang people rushed out of the great hall like a storm, heading towards the place where the shouts of battle could be heard.

* * *

Not long after, Han Li returned to his residence, reactivated the restrictions, and sat on the bed. He pondered with a glint in his eyes. He had killed the leader of the Aura royals and sent out the Leopard Scaled Beast, so the battle on the Earth Star was as good as over. With this, he had repaid the favor of Madam Hwa giving him the precious elixir, so he could rest for about half a year and then leave. Han Li suddenly thought of something and turned his palm over, taking out the black handkerchief. It was a treasure he had obtained from the two Aura royals. He carefully examined the handkerchief, and the black spell characters shimmering on its surface made it clear that it was no ordinary treasure.
